How to Prepare & Consume
Blend ripe mango and fresh orange juice until smooth. For added nutrition, consider adding spinach or protein powder.
Smart Selection & Storage
Choose ripe mangoes that yield slightly to pressure and oranges that are firm and heavy for their size.
Store the smoothie in an airtight container in the refrigerator and consume within 24 hours for best quality.

Mango Orange Protein Power Smoothie
This protein-packed smoothie combines the refreshing flavors of mango and orange with Greek yogurt for a perfect pre-workout boost.
- 1 cup Pre-Workout Mango Orange Juice Smoothie
- 1/2 cup Greek yogurt
- 1 tablespoon honey
- 1 tablespoon chia seeds
- 1. Blend all ingredients until smooth.
- 2. Pour into a glass and enjoy immediately.
- 3. For added texture, sprinkle chia seeds on top before serving.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Can I use frozen mango for this smoothie?
Yes, frozen mango can be used and will give the smoothie a thicker texture.
Is this smoothie suitable for weight loss?
In moderation, this smoothie can be part of a weight loss plan due to its fiber content.
How can I make this smoothie vegan?
This smoothie is naturally vegan as it contains only fruits and juice.
Can I add protein powder to this smoothie?
Yes, adding protein powder can enhance the smoothie’s nutritional profile, especially for muscle recovery.
How long can I store this smoothie?
It is best consumed fresh, but can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ours.
